"The hotel is fantastic, the staff was so friendly, the food spread was delicious and variable. The breakfast was my favourite, fresh guacamole, amongst other things, was the best way to start the day! For those wanting to travel by bus there is a bus stop right outside the hotel. It takes about 40 minutes to get to the city centre. There is also a QR code listed at the stop which tells in how many minutes the bus will arrive at the stop, this is extremely handy for planning the departure time...

#### Planning Your Trip to Guadalmar\n
  • Hottest months: July, August, June and September, with an average temperature of 25°C
  • Coldest months: January, February, March and December
  • Driest months: July, August, June and September
  • Rainiest months: November, March, December and January
